Safety

Safety is the most important factor when it is about bunk beds for kids bunk bed. It is essential to select the most durable bed that is made of top-quality materials. Make sure that the bunk bed is stocked with guardrails along the entire length of the mattresses to prevent accidents while sleeping. Check the guardrails to see if they are damaged and ensure that they are at least 5 inches higher than the mattress surface. This will protect your child if he or gets up while sleeping or climbs on the rails to play.

It's also important to teach your children the rules of bunk bed safety. For instance, they should, use the ladder with caution and only use the upper bed to sleep. It is also advised not to hang items from the rails, like scarves, jump ropes or belts. This could cause serious injuries and strangulation. It is also important to keep the area around the bunk bed free of clutter and sharp objects.

A Kids Bunkbed with Ladder and Guardrails

It is crucial to look over the safety features of a bunk bed before you purchase one for your children. This will ensure that they are safe at night. The ladder must be secured securely and at an angle that makes it easy to climb, while also preventing falling. The ideal ladder will be designed to support the weight of an infant sleeping.

To improve the stability of your bunk bed, place it in a corner with walls on both sides. It's also recommended to put a night-light next to the ladder, so that your children are able to see it at night. It is also recommended to avoid placing furniture or other objects in front of the bunk beds uk bed as this can make it difficult for your kids to get to the top bunk.

To reduce the risk of injury the majority of bunk bed manufacturers have established age restrictions for children who sleep on the upper bunk. It's also important to ensure the integrity of the structure by checking regularly for loose bolts or screws. Do not place the bed near windows or heaters.
